Position Summary

The State Pre-College Enrichment Program (S-PREP) is a free high school and college preparation program for 7th -12th grade students who reside in New York City. The objective of the program is to increase the number of underrepresented students pursuing careers in healthcare or related STEM professions. The program offers academic enrichment courses that are designed to prepare students for success in math and science. The program also offers career development workshops, college advisement services, field trips and college tours.

Program Facilitators for the S-PREP program will assist with managing math and science courses for middle and high school students. Program participants come from diverse backgrounds and generally have varying academic skillsets. This is a great opportunity to assist with exercising curriculum construction, establishing/executing course instruction and differentiation skills. Course offerings will include, but may not be limited to Algebra, Biology, Chemistry, Geometry, Pre-Calculus, Statistics, Anatomy & Computer Science.
